Output c94af9de54218c53afcbddcbb9968780acde62681101e8fa8c9ab7eaba3c080a:41

value
2641536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eece89f23dbe81b73f99aec898de3ea11e4091d0 OP_EQUAL
address
3PTiAme43RxxuHt6FdBVoVFQVMjdQsstPD
transaction
c94af9de54218c53afcbddcbb9968780acde62681101e8fa8c9ab7eaba3c080a
spent
true